什么是DNS查询「dns查询什么意思」

DNS查询是域名系统(Domain Names System)的一部分,它是一种将域名转换为IP地址的服务。简单来说,DNS就像一个翻译官,将域名翻译成IP地址。

DNS查询是什么?

什么是DNS查询「dns查询什么意思」

DNS(Domain Name System,域名系统)是互联网的一项核心服务,它作为将域名和IP地址相互映射的一个分布式数据库,能够使人更方便地访问互联网,而DNS查询就是通过这个系统,将用户输入的域名转换成相应的IP地址的过程。

DNS查询的过程可以分为以下几个步骤:

1、用户在浏览器中输入网址时,浏览器会先进行DNS缓存查询,看是否已经有了该网址对应的IP地址记录,如果有,则直接返回IP地址;如果没有,则继续下一步。

2、浏览器向本地DNS服务器发送查询请求,本地DNS服务器可能是由网络管理员设置的,也可能是用户自己设置的,如果本地DNS服务器中没有该网址对应的IP地址记录,则会向根DNS服务器发送查询请求。

3、根DNS服务器会返回下一级DNS服务器的信息,通常是一个或多个顶级域DNS服务器的地址。.com、.org、.net等。

4、浏览器向顶级域DNS服务器发送查询请求,顶级域DNS服务器会返回相应的权威DNS服务器的信息。

5、浏览器向权威DNS服务器发送查询请求,权威DNS服务器会返回该网址对应的IP地址记录。

6、浏览器接收到IP地址后,就可以使用该地址与目标网站进行通信了。

DNS查询是将用户输入的域名转换成相应的IP地址的过程,它涉及到多个层次的DNS服务器之间的交互和解析,通过这个过程,用户可以方便地访问互联网上的各种资源。

相关问题与解答:

Q: 如何修改本地DNS服务器?

A: 在Windows系统中,可以通过“控制面板”->“网络和Internet”->“网络和共享中心”->“更改适配器设置”来查看当前使用的网络连接,右键点击选择“属性”,在弹出的窗口中选择“Internet协议版本4(TCP/IPv4)”,点击“属性”按钮,在弹出的窗口中选择“使用下面的DNS服务器地址”,然后输入要使用的DNS服务器地址即可,在Mac系统中,可以在“系统偏好设置”->“网络”中找到当前使用的网络连接,点击右侧的“高级”按钮,在弹出的窗口中选择“DNS”选项卡,然后输入要使用的DNS服务器地址即可。

Q: 为什么有些网站需要使用HTTPS而不是HTTP?它们之间有什么区别?

A: HTTPS是一种安全的传输协议,它可以在客户端和服务器之间建立一个加密通道来保护数据的传输安全,相比于HTTP,HTTPS需要对数据进行加密和解密处理,所以它的传输速度会比HTTP慢一些,HTTPS还需要使用数字证书来验证网站的身份和安全性,因此需要一定的成本和技术实现,但是为了保护用户的隐私和数据安全,很多网站都已经开始使用HTTPS来传输数据了。

图片来源于互联网,如侵权请联系管理员。发布者:观察员,转转请注明出处:https://www.kname.net/ask/13735.html

(0)
观察员观察员
上一篇 2024年1月15日 10:51
下一篇 2024年1月15日 10:57

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注